How much do platform engineer jobs pay per hour?

As of Sep 15, 2026, the average hourly pay for platform engineer in Wisconsin is $64.55, according to ZipRecruiter salary data. Most workers in this role earn between $50.96 and $74.47 per hour, depending on experience, location, and employer.

What are the key skills and qualifications needed to thrive as a platform engineer, and why are they important?

To thrive as a Platform Engineer, you need a solid background in computer science, systems architecture, and cloud infrastructure, often supported by a relevant degree or equivalent experience. Familiarity with containerization tools (like Docker and Kubernetes), infrastructure-as-code platforms (such as Terraform), and cloud services (AWS, Azure, or GCP) is typically required, along with relevant certifications. Strong problem-solving skills, collaboration, and effective communication help Platform Engineers drive reliability and innovation within technical teams. These competencies are crucial for building scalable, secure, and efficient platforms that support an organization's technology needs.

How does a platform engineer typically collaborate with development and operations teams?

Platform Engineers work closely with both development and operations teams to design, build, and maintain scalable infrastructure and deployment pipelines. They often serve as a bridge, ensuring that applications can be deployed reliably and efficiently while meeting the requirements of both teams. Regular communication is key, as Platform Engineers gather feedback from developers about tooling needs and coordinate with operations to uphold system stability and security. This collaborative environment fosters automation, streamlines workflows, and supports continuous delivery practices.

What is the difference between Platform Engineer vs DevOps Engineer?

AspectPlatform EngineerDevOps Engineer
CredentialsBachelor's in CS or related field, often cloud certificationsBachelor's in CS, DevOps certifications (e.g., Docker, Kubernetes)
Work EnvironmentDesigning and building platform infrastructure, working with cloud servicesAutomating deployment, CI/CD pipelines, and system operations
Industry UsageTech companies, cloud providers, SaaS firmsSoftware development, IT operations, cloud services

Platform Engineers focus on creating and maintaining the underlying infrastructure and platforms, while DevOps Engineers streamline development and deployment processes through automation. Both roles collaborate closely but have distinct focuses within the software development lifecycle.

Do platform engineers make good money?

Platform engineers typically earn competitive salaries that vary based on experience, location, and industry. They often have skills in cloud computing, automation, and scripting, which can lead to higher compensation levels compared to other engineering roles.

What will a platform engineer do?

A platform engineer designs, builds, and maintains the underlying infrastructure and tools that support software development and deployment. They work with cloud services, automation, and scripting to ensure scalable, reliable, and efficient systems, often using technologies like Kubernetes, Docker, and CI/CD pipelines.

Job Description:

This role requires working on-site four days per week at our New York, Seattle, or Milwaukee office.

As a Data Platform Engineer,you will lead the design, development, and optimization of scalable data platforms that support enterprise-level warehousing,analyticsand reporting. Leveraging your deepexpertisein ETL technologies, Azure cloud services, and Snowflake, you will architect robust data pipelines, ensure data quality, and enable seamless data integration across systems. You will collaborate closely with data architects, analysts, and business stakeholders to deliver high-performance, cost-effective data solutions that align with organizational goals. Your role will also involve mentoring junior engineers,promotingbest practices, and driving continuous improvement in data engineering standards and platform reliability.

Your Core Responsibilities:

  • Design, develop, andmaintainend-to-end distributed data pipelines to support analytics, reporting, and operational workflows.

  • Build scalable, modular, and efficient data transformationtooptimizeenterprise level data ingestion, transformation, and loading processes using modern ETL frameworks and cloud-native tools.

  • Architect and administer Snowflake data warehouses, including performance tuning, resource management, and security configurations.

  • Design and develop scalable BI solutions using Power BI or other reporting tools (Tableau, Cognos), including data modelling, transformation, visualization, and performance optimization to deliver actionable insights.

  • Develop and enforce data quality, data governance, and metadata management practices.

  • Partner with data architects, analysts, and business stakeholders to understand data requirements and translate them into technical solutions.

  • Maintain strong documentation and adhere to SDLC and DevOps best practices.

Your Expertise

  • 3+years ofData Engineeringexperiencerequired

  • Priorexperience of working in Finance domain

  • Bachelor's degree in computer science, Mathematics, Statistics, or related engineering fieldrequired. Advanced degree preferred.

  • Hands-on experience with Snowflake,dbt,FiveTran/CensusandotherETL tools

  • Expertisein SQL,Pythonor other scripting languages

  • Workingknowledgeinvestment data vendors suchBloomberg,MSCI,Compustat,Worldscope, I/B/E/S, FTSE/Russell,IDCand other similar datasets

  • Understandingof Investment Managementdata domainsincluding Security Masters, Reference data,Indexes, Positions (IBOR, ABOR, trades), Performance and Analytics across different asset classes

  • Strong analytical mindset and attention to detail

  • Comfort working in cross-functional settings with business and tech teams

  • Experience withC#, .NET, ASP.NET Core (MVC + Web API), Entity Framework, SQL Server, JavaScript, Service-Oriented Architecture, Web APIs, Frontend frameworksa plus
